Eilat: The Gem of the Red Sea

Nestled at the southern tip of Israel, Eilat is a vibrant city that beautifully combines history, natural beauty, and modern resort life. Mentioned in the Bible as "Elath", this ancient port city was a significant hub for trade and navigation, as referenced in the book of "Kings". It was here that King Solomon’s fleet set off on maritime journeys, making it a place of great historical importance.

 

In 1948, following the establishment of the State of Israel, Eilat was founded anew. Since then, it has blossomed into a premier tourist destination, attracting visitors from around the globe with its stunning beaches, warm climate, and rich aquatic life.

The Wonders of the Red Sea

Eilat is famously located along the shores of the Red Sea, renowned for its crystal-clear waters and vibrant coral reefs. This underwater paradise is home to a spectacular array of marine life, including colorful fish, sea turtles, and even dolphins. Snorkeling and diving in Eilat's coral reefs are unforgettable experiences, offering a glimpse into a world teeming with life.

A Year-Round Weather Resort

One of Eilat's greatest gifts is its wonderful weather. With over 300 sunny days a year, it’s an ideal getaway for sun-seekers and adventure enthusiasts alike. The warm climate allows for year-round exploration, whether you're lounging on the beach, hiking in the nearby mountains, or indulging in water sports.
